Kirk Herbstreit drops Ohio State a spot in his college football rankings after week four

It’s no secret that former Ohio State quarterback and current ESPN analyst Kirk Herbstreit has a love/hate relationship with Buckeye fans. He does his best to remain partial, but some OSU fans see him as a turncoat that will run as far away from the perception that he’s a homer, so much so that he doesn’t give Ohio State the credit its due.

Well, welcome to another installment of that battle between the scarlet and gray ying and the yang because Herbie just released his top four college football teams after week 4, and he has dropped Ohio State — even after a 76-5 bludgeoning in which the Buckeyes couldn’t have played much better.

In previous weeks, Herbstreit had had OSU as his No. 3 team, but he has apparently seen enough of LSU and former Buckeye quarterback Joe Burrow to elevate the Bayou Tigers ahead of Ohio State.

To be fair, it’s all a matter of opinion, and at this point it’s hard to separate the teams at the top because the differences seem razor thin. But — that won’t stop Ohio State fans from giving the ESPN analyst an ear full through social media.
